1. What is the best kind of hob for a little cooking area?

For little kitchen areas, a portable hob or a smaller induction hob is often ideal due to their compact size and versatility.

2. Are induction hobs safe for families with kids?

Yes, induction hobs are typically thought about more secure as they just warm up when a compatible pot is put on them, considerably reducing the threat of burns.

3. How do I keep my hob?

Regular cleaning with mild, non-abrasive cleaners is important. For gas [hobs oven](https://ovensandhobs-uk78166.wikibyby.com/2317636/five_things_everybody_does_wrong_concerning_hobs_sale), make sure the burners are cleaned up and checked for blockages.

4. Do I need unique pots and pans for induction hobs?

Yes, induction hobs require cookware that is ferrous (magnetic). Typical products appropriate include cast iron and some stainless steels.

5. Can I set up a gas hob myself?

While some may try to install a gas hob themselves, it is typically recommended to work with a professional to make sure safety requirements and proper ventilation are satisfied.
